How To Measure Wrist Size
FIT YOUR UNIQUE BRACELET TO YOUR EXACT NEEDS TAILOR TO YOUR SIZE
If you don’t have the chance to try on bracelets in person,
it’s best to know your wrist size before shopping online.
This not only helps you achieve a stylish look
but also avoids the trouble of choosing a piece that’s too tight or too loose.

When measuring your wrist keep the tape close to your skin
and avoid adding any extra length.
Find the one that works best for you.

METHOD 1 | MEASURING TAPE
Prepare a measuring tape and wrap it around your wrist.
Take the measured length and add 0.5 inches to determine your ideal bracelet size.

METHOD 2 | String and Ruler
※The string should be non-elastic
Wrap a piece of string around the wrist where you plan to wear the bracelet.
Mark the point where the string overlaps with a pen or pencil,
then measure the length of the string with a ruler.
That will be your wrist size.

METHOD 3 | Existing Bracelet
Take a bracelet you already own and measure the inner diameter at its widest point.
Then, compare it with the size of the bracelet you plan to purchase.

Different bead sizes and designs affect bracelet length.
Larger beads result in different lengths compared to smaller ones,
even if both fit the wrist the same way.
Wrist size measurement ensures every bracelet fits you perfectly,
regardless of bead size or design.
